What is the oxidation state of phosphorus in H3PO3?
What is the oxidation state of phosphorus in the following:
H3PO3
Advertisements
Solution
Let the oxidation state of P be x.
H3PO3
3 + x + 3(−2) = 0
3 + x − 6 = 0
x − 3 = 0
x = +3
